在numpy中,可以使用切片操作对包含多个变量的列表进行切片。切片操作可以通过指定起始索引、结束索引和步长来选择列表中的特定元素。
下面是对numpy中包含多个变量的列表进行切片的示例代码:
import numpy as np
# 创建包含多个变量的列表
data = np.array([[1, 2, 3], [4, 5, 6], [7, 8, 9]])
# 对列表进行切片操作
sliced_data = data[:, 1:3] # 切片第1列到第2列(不包括第3列)
print(sliced_data)
输出结果为:
[[2 3]
[5 6]
[8 9]]
在上述示例中,我们首先导入了numpy库,并创建了一个包含多个变量的列表data
。然后,我们使用切片操作[:, 1:3]
对列表进行切片。切片操作中的:
表示选择所有行,1:3
表示选择第1列到第2列(不包括第3列)。最后,我们打印出切片后的结果sliced_data
。
切片操作可以根据具体需求进行灵活的调整。你可以根据需要选择特定的行、列,也可以指定步长来跳过一些元素。通过切片操作,可以方便地对numpy中包含多个变量的列表进行数据处理和分析。
推荐的腾讯云相关产品:腾讯云云服务器(CVM)和腾讯云云数据库MySQL。
云+社区沙龙online [国产数据库]
云原生正发声
云+社区技术沙龙[第10期]
T-Day
企业创新在线学堂
云+社区技术沙龙[第12期]
GAME-TECH
领取专属 10元无门槛券
手把手带您无忧上云